This issue concerns GNU Emacs 20 handling of password prompts. Passwords typed into functions such as read-passwd could remain in recently typed key history, allowing someone with access to that history to read them in clear text. Exposure appears limited to legacy environments where GNU Emacs 20 remains installed or used, especially shared Unix-like systems or workflows that enter secrets into Emacs password prompts. Treat as a targeted legacy exposure item, not an emergency, unless Emacs 20 is present on shared systems handling privileged credentials. Prioritize inventory and retirement of unsupported editor versions. Mitigation focus: Inventory systems for GNU Emacs 20 usage.; Check GNU Emacs or distribution vendor guidance for fixed or supported versions.; Retire or isolate legacy Emacs 20 installations where practical..
